About Chino Hills

Chino Hills is renowned for its rolling hills, spacious properties, and master-planned communities. The area features excellent schools including Ayala High School and multiple highly-rated elementary schools. Residents enjoy access to beautiful parks, hiking trails, and recreational facilities throughout the community. Shopping and dining options include The Shoppes at Chino Hills and diverse restaurants. The location provides convenient freeway access to Orange County employment centers while maintaining a distinct community identity.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of homes are available under $800K in Chino Hills? +
The under-$800K market includes condominiums, townhomes, and single-family residences. Condos and townhomes typically range from $350K-$550K, while single-family homes span $450K-$800K depending on size, age, and location within Chino Hills' various neighborhoods.
Are Chino Hills schools really as good as people say? +
Yes, Chino Hills schools consistently rank among the best in San Bernardino County. Chino Valley Unified School District includes highly-rated elementary, middle, and high schools. The top-rated schools are a primary reason many families choose this community, supporting strong property values and buyer demand.
What is the average time on market for homes under $800K? +
Market time varies by property condition and price point. Well-maintained homes priced competitively typically sell within 30-45 days. Homes needing updates may take 60-90 days. Spring and summer see faster sales velocity than winter months in Chino Hills.
How do property taxes work in Chino Hills? +
California property taxes are approximately 1% of assessed home value plus voter-approved bonds. Chino Hills also has varying HOA fees depending on neighborhood, typically $200-$400 monthly. Your agent can provide exact estimates based on specific properties you're considering.
What's the commute like from Chino Hills to major employment centers? +
Chino Hills offers excellent freeway access via Highway 71 and 60. Commutes to Orange County are 30-45 minutes, while Los Angeles and Inland Empire destinations are 45-60 minutes. Many residents appreciate the suburban setting balanced with reasonable access to regional job markets.
